History

1947

Kosei Suisan K.K. established in Minato-ku, Tokyo.
Kurihama Plant opens in Kanagawa.


1950

Industrial production of chondroitin sulfate as a pharmaceutical begins.


1952

Head Office relocated to Chuo-ku, Tokyo.


1953

Official name of company changed to K.K. Seikagaku Kenkyusho.


1960

Tokyo Research Institute opens in Shinjuku-ku, Tokyo.
Development and marketing of research biochemicals begins.


1962

Official name of company changed to Seikagaku Corporation.


1968

Tokyo Research Institute relocated to Higashiyamato-shi, Tokyo.


1975

Takahagi Plant opens in Ibaraki.


1981

World's first endotoxin colorimetry reagent developed and manufactured.


1987

Marketing begins for hyaluronic acid formulations ARTZ® and OPEGAN®.


1989

Company shares registered with the Japan Securities Dealers Association.


1992

Overseas marketing of ARTZ® begins (Sweden).


1993

New production line for ARTZ Dispo® completed, and marketing of the product begins.


1997

Acquisition of Associates of Cape Cod, Inc. (U.S.A.)


1998

QA certification [ISO 9001/EN46001 (now ISO 13485)] obtained.


2000

Name of Tokyo Research Institute changed to Central Research Laboratories.


2001

Marketing begins for hyaluronic acid formulation SUPARTZ® in U.S.A.


2004

Listing moved to the Tokyo Stock Exchange, Second Section.


2005

Listing moved to the Tokyo Stock Exchange, First Section.
Head Office relocated to Chiyoda-ku, Tokyo.


2007

Marketing begins for a hyaluronic acid medical device MucoUp®.
Seikagaku Biobusiness Corporation established.
